NASA Visualizes What it Would Be Wish to Plunge right into a Black Gap – WATCH


Visible simulation of coming into a black gap – by Jeremy Schnittman, astrophysicist at Goddard Area Flight Heart / NASA

Counting on a supercomputer and the individuals with expertise sufficient to make use of it, NASA scientists have produced a video illustration of what it might be prefer to float right into a black gap for those who had been one way or the other invincible.

Being that throughout the occasion horizon of a black gap, the legal guidelines of normal relativity break down, it’s extraordinarily tough to say or to foretell what would occur to an object, however we do know from latest observations what can occur with mild.

A number of variations of the identical simulation are defined in a 4-minute video launched by NASA that provides visible aids to some extraordinarily complicated physics.

“Individuals typically ask about [what it would be like to fall into a black hole] and simulating these difficult-to-imagine processes helps me join the arithmetic of relativity to precise penalties in the true universe,” mentioned Jeremy Schnittman, an astrophysicist at NASA’s Goddard Area Flight Heart in Greenbelt, Maryland, who created the visualizations.

“So I simulated two completely different eventualities, one the place a digicam—a stand-in for a daring astronaut—simply misses the occasion horizon and slingshots again out, and one the place it crosses the boundary, sealing its destiny.”

The video is extra than simply fluff, each characteristic of it corresponds with exact calculations that might have as soon as been a printed paper launched to nice acclaim. The simulation set the goal as a supermassive black gap just like the one on the middle of our galaxy. The digicam was set 400 million miles from the 25 million mile-wide black gap, and because it approaches, the new disk of mud and fuel that swirls round a black gap, referred to as an accretion disk, begins to elongate and brighten.

This is identical impact as when the sound of an approaching racecar is amplified primarily based on its velocity.

Then, the supercomputer takes over, and the markers of sunshine, specifically the celebs, the accretion disk, and a band of photon rings, that are thinner and made up of sunshine orbiting contained in the occasion horizon, start to warp.

The challenge generated about 10 terabytes of information—equal to roughly half of the estimated textual content content material within the Library of Congress—and took about 5 days what would have taken a traditional pc a decade.
